Title: Scheduler double-waters bed 3 after DST shift

New folks: the Verdella scheduler stores watering slots in local time. After the clock change, slot 06:00 fires twice, soaking the herb bed. Fix: store UTC, convert at display. Repro on the Oakhollow test rig only. To reproduce, install the firmware identified by the token below.

build token for hafop-kahog: htk31_a432ac515d5bb1362002c1e1a7e80ef

Handover — Vexler partner SFTP drop

Ownership moves to you today. Drop runs hourly from Vexler's end into the intake bucket via the relay host. Watch for zero-byte files; their exporter flakes on Mondays. Creds live in the ops vault, path noted in the runbook. Vault auto-seals after 48h idle. Support escalations go to the on-call rotation, not me. If the vault is sealed when you need it, unseal with the recovery passphrase below.

recovery phrase for tadug-fafof: zorwyn-kasion

Ticket: Staging env misconfigured for Siftgate bloom filter

The bloom layer in front of the Pellet KV store is rejecting all lookups in staging because the env file was copied from the dev template without credentials. False-positive tuning values are fine; only the auth line is missing. To unblock the weekly demo, the Pellet admission secret must be set on the following line.

env line for yaguf-fajop: LEDGER_TOKEN13=fb08984397349

## Step 4: Update catalogue import hooks

The Shelfwright catalogue importer now streams records in batches instead of loading the full file. Plugin authors must switch from the `onImport` callback to the batch-aware `onBatch` hook; the old callback is removed in this release. Your plugin will receive batches sized according to the following importer configuration.

config for kafof-bawef:
holath:
  log_level: debug
  metrics_host: metrics.holath.qorvelsys.internal
  pin: 2191
  pool_size: 32

### Quillbench Admin 4.2 — changed defaults

Heads up for the release: bulk edits in the admin table now default to a dry-run preview instead of applying immediately, and the max selected rows dropped from 500 to 200. Folks who relied on instant apply will grumble, so flag it in the notes. The new default values ship as follows.

service settings:
PRAIX_LOG_LEVEL=error
PRAIX_METRICS_HOST=metrics.praix.qorvelcorp.corp
PRAIX_POOL_SIZE=16